Description

Quint is a dynamic community-based organization dedicated to fostering sustainable development and positive change in Saskatoons core neighbourhoods. Our team is passionate about creating opportunities and improving the quality of life for the neighbourhoods we serve through our work in affordable housing, employment, and social enterprise.  We are seeking a dynamic Outreach Worker for our social enterprise programs which employ individuals facing barriers to employment such as previous contact with the justice system, housing insecurity, lack of education and experience, etc. This position works to support the crew and develop strategies to reduce personal or professional barriers in the lives of our participants.


Duties:
Work with crew members to identify and achieve personal and professional goals.
Recognize and address barriers through solution-focused interventions.
Maintain case files for ongoing follow-up.
Participate in crew onboarding and intake processes.
Identify community resources, education, and training opportunities.
Collaborate with senior staff to create a training program tailored to crew needs.
Develop transition plans for participants exiting the program, focused on employment or education.
Build networks with local stakeholders to enhance transitional opportunities.
Occasionally transport crew members as needed.

Skills:
Ability to build trust and relationships with diverse populations.
Empathetic, non-judgmental, and patient approach.
Strong problem-solving, time management, and organizational skills.
Ability to prioritize and track/report data effectively.

Education & Experience:
Understanding of poverty and employment barriers for marginalized groups.
Extensive knowledge of community resources.
Familiarity with Harm Reduction practices.
Experience in human or social services is an asset.

Conditions:
Valid drivers license, access to a vehicle, and a Criminal Record & Vulnerable Sector Check required.
